Abstract
We review in detail modern numerical methods used in the determination and solution of Bethe-Salpeter and Dyson-Schwinger equations. The algorithms and techniques described are applicable to both the rainbow-ladder truncation and its non-trivial extensions. We discuss pedagogically the steps involved in constructing conventional mesons and baryons as systems of two- and three-quarks respectively. As further application we describe the self-consistent calculation of form-factors and highlight the challenges that remain therein. (C) 2018 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
